Metz and Sigma (and probably some others) make P-TTL flashes - but I would stick with the OEM ones. I've got an AF360 and am quite happy with it. I had an AF540 for a few hours but it had an issue with zooming. (It was a Craigslist buy and I was able to return it.) I have an older flash that has a swivel head if I need that - but usually if I want to shoot in portrait, I'll just have the onboard flash trigger the AF360 wirelessly.

The AF360 is a good bit cheaper so I would give that consideration over a third-party flash, even though you give up the swivel head and possibly some strength over the top third-party ones. You also may have issues with third-party flashes when Pentax introduces a new body - some flashes have needed firmware updates in the past; not the case with the OEM ones.
